Description:
This fantastic Jefferson County hunting and timber investment property has now been reduced to only $2,300 per acre! This property contains approximately 100 acres of scattered fields, beautiful hardwood covered hills and hollows and scattered stands of mature pines. It has a great interior road system and electricity and water on sight. The property is traversed by Stampley Creek and adjoins thousands of acres of large, privately owned lands. The property has been family owned for around 100 years and the old family home is now being used for a hunting camp. The open land is suitable for livestock, large food plots and dove fields. The deer, turkey and squirrel hunting on this property is excellent with trophy deer killed in the area every year. If the buyer is interested in a lake, there are numerous lake sites ranging in size from just a few acres to over 25 acres. Rick, his wife Tammy and 3 of their 5 children live in McComb. Besides being the broker for Mossy Oak Properties, Forest Investments, Rick is a registered forester and a member of the REALTORS Land Institute, having achieved the coveted "Accredited Land Consultant" (ALC) designation and has earned Mossy Oak Properties' "Certified Land Specialist" designation. He wrote the RLI course "Timberland: Identifying and Evaluating Timberland as an Investment" and is currently the only instructor for the course which is a two day, 16 hour course and applies towards the Accredited Land Consultant Designation". Rick is one of the original inductees into Mossy Oak Properties' "Pinnacle Club" which recognizes the top producing agents in the Mossy Oak Properties network. He was named "2010 Land REALTOR of the Year" by the Mississippi chapter of the REALTOR'S Land Institute and served as Mississippi's RLI president for 2011. Rick graduated in 1979 with a degree in forestry from Louisiana Tech University and is experienced in timber and land procurement, forest management, logging, wildlife management and oil and gas leasing. He first got his real estate license in 1988 and started Forest Investments in 1998. Rick is licensed in Mississippi and Louisiana.
